An Epic Story That Pulls You In

"The Witcher 3" is based on the popular fantasy series by Andrzej Sapkowski and follows Geralt of Rivia, a lone monster hunter known as a Witcher. The narrative is rich with lore, complex characters, and a world that feels like it’s been spun out of the pages of a fantasy novel. The game’s story is one of personal revenge, political intrigue, and an epic quest that spans across a continent known as the Continent.

The narrative is beautifully woven with deep character development, unexpected twists, and poignant moments that make you care about the characters and the world they inhabit. This attention to storytelling has been lauded by critics and players who appreciate a game that doesn’t just entertain, but also makes you think and feel.

Engaging and Rewarding Gameplay

The gameplay in "The Witcher 3" is a blend of combat, exploration, and puzzle-solving. As Geralt, you have access to a variety of skills and abilities that you can use to fight a wide array of enemies, from ghouls to dragons. The combat system is deep and rewarding, with options for combo attacks, critical strikes, and the use of alchemy to mix potions for healing and buffs.

In addition to combat, exploration is key. You’ll find hidden areas, collectibles, and side quests that flesh out the story and add depth to the world. The game’s inventory and crafting systems are intuitive, allowing you to make your own potions and weapons to suit your playstyle.
